随着二十世纪微电子技术的发展,小型化的电子设备日益增多,这就对电源提出了很高的要求,锂电池随之进入了大规模的实用阶段,最早得以应用的是锂亚原电池,用于心脏起搏器中,由于锂亚电池的自放电率极低,放电电压十分平缓,使得起搏器植入人体长期使用成为可能,锂锰电池一般具有高于3.0伏的标称电压,更适合作集成电路电源,广泛用于计算机、计算器和手表中,而锂离子电池则大量应用在手机、笔记本电脑、电动工具、电动车、路灯备用电源、航灯和家用小电器上,可以说是最大的应用群体,未完成的锂电池在加工时则需要进行固定。With the development of microelectronics technology in the twentieth century, the number of miniaturized electronic devices is increasing, which puts forward high requirements for power supply, and lithium batteries have entered a large-scale practical stage. Batteries are used in cardiac pacemakers. Due to the extremely low self-discharge rate of lithium sub-battery and the very gentle discharge voltage, it is possible to implant the pacemaker into the human body for long-term use. Lithium-manganese batteries generally have a nominal value higher than 3.0 volts. Voltage, more suitable for integrated circuit power supply, widely used in computers, calculators and watches, while lithium-ion batteries are widely used in mobile phones, notebook computers, power tools, electric vehicles, street lamp backup power, navigation lights and small household appliances. , can be said to be the largest application group, and the unfinished lithium battery needs to be fixed during processing.

为实现上述便于固定的目的,本实用新型提供如下技术方案:一种特种锂电池充放电锂电池固定装置,包括底座,所述底座的顶部固定安装有存放箱,所述底座顶部的左右两侧均开设有螺纹孔,所述存放箱的内部活动安装有移动板,所述存放箱的内顶壁上固定安装有与移动板固定连接的限位弹簧,所述移动板的顶部固定安装有缓冲板,所述缓冲板的顶部固定安装有锂电池,所述锂电池的顶部固定安装有手把,所述存放箱的左右两侧均开设有散热孔,所述存放箱的左右两侧的内壁上均开设有限位槽,所述限位槽的内部活动安装有限位板,所述限位板的相背侧固定安装有限位环,所述存放箱的左右两侧均螺纹连接有与限位环活动连接的螺纹杆,所述限位板的相对侧固定安装有位于锂电池顶部的限位块,所述螺纹杆的相背侧固定安装有调节旋钮。In order to achieve the above purpose of being easy to fix, the utility model provides the following technical solution: a special lithium battery charging and discharging lithium battery fixing device, including a base, a storage box is fixedly installed on the top of the base, and the left and right sides of the top of the base are fixedly installed. Both are provided with threaded holes, the interior of the storage box is movably installed with a moving plate, the inner top wall of the storage box is fixedly installed with a limit spring that is fixedly connected to the moving plate, and the top of the moving plate is fixedly installed with a buffer The top of the buffer plate is fixedly installed with a lithium battery, the top of the lithium battery is fixedly installed with a handle, the left and right sides of the storage box are provided with heat dissipation holes, and the inner walls of the left and right sides of the storage box are provided with heat dissipation holes. Limiting grooves are set on the upper part, and a limiter plate is movably installed inside the limiter groove, a limiter ring is fixedly installed on the opposite side of the limiter plate, and the left and right sides of the storage box are threadedly connected with a limiter plate. A threaded rod that is movably connected to the ring, a limit block located on the top of the lithium battery is fixedly installed on the opposite side of the limit plate, and an adjustment knob is fixedly installed on the opposite side of the threaded rod.

优选的,所述存放箱的内壁上开设有移动槽,且移动板通过限位槽与存放箱活动连接。Preferably, the inner wall of the storage box is provided with a moving slot, and the moving plate is movably connected to the storage box through the limiting slot.

优选的,所述限位弹簧的数量不少于三个,且限位弹簧呈等间距分布。Preferably, the number of the limit springs is not less than three, and the limit springs are distributed at equal intervals.

优选的,所述限位环的内部固定安装有轴承,且螺纹杆通过轴承与限位环活动连接。Preferably, a bearing is fixedly installed inside the limit ring, and the threaded rod is movably connected to the limit ring through the bearing.

优选的,所述限位块的相对侧采用倾斜设计,且限位块的倾斜角度为四十五度。Preferably, the opposite sides of the limiting block adopt an inclined design, and the inclination angle of the limiting block is forty-five degrees.

优选的,所述调节旋钮的外侧开设有防滑齿槽,且防滑齿槽均匀分布与调节旋钮的外侧。Preferably, the outside of the adjusting knob is provided with anti-slip tooth grooves, and the anti-slip tooth grooves are evenly distributed on the outside of the adjusting knob.

(三)有益效果(3) Beneficial effects

与现有技术相比,本实用新型提供了一种特种锂电池充放电锂电池固定装置,具备以下有益效果:Compared with the prior art, the utility model provides a special lithium battery charging and discharging lithium battery fixing device, which has the following beneficial effects:

该特种锂电池充放电锂电池固定装置,通过设置限位弹簧和限位块,在对特种锂电池进行固定时,只需推动锂电池,经过缓冲板使移动板受力,对限位弹簧进行挤压,从而使压缩弹簧受力压缩,移动板会向下滑动,锂电池就会跟着向下移动,当锂电池的顶部移动到限位块的下方时,转动调节旋钮,使螺纹杆发生转动,螺纹杆会推动限位板在限位槽中移动,限位块就会移动到锂电池的上方,然后松开锂电池即可,操作简单,对锂电池的固定的时间较短,固定的效率较高,使用起来比较方便,同时限位弹簧处于压缩状态,能够持续给锂电池压力,进而避免锂电池出现松动的情况,使用起来更加方便。The special lithium battery charging and discharging lithium battery fixing device, by setting the limit spring and the limit block, when fixing the special lithium battery, only need to push the lithium battery, and the moving plate is stressed through the buffer plate, and the limit spring is adjusted. Squeeze, so that the compression spring is compressed by force, the moving plate will slide down, and the lithium battery will move down. When the top of the lithium battery moves to the bottom of the limit block, turn the adjustment knob to make the threaded rod rotate. , the threaded rod will push the limit plate to move in the limit slot, the limit block will move to the top of the lithium battery, and then loosen the lithium battery, the operation is simple, the fixing time of the lithium battery is short, and the fixing efficiency It is higher and more convenient to use. At the same time, the limit spring is in a compressed state, which can continue to put pressure on the lithium battery, thereby avoiding the looseness of the lithium battery, and it is more convenient to use.
